Understanding the Three of Wands Tarot Card
The Three of Wands is a Minor Arcana card that symbolizes foresight, expansion, and the anticipation of future possibilities. In traditional tarot decks, it often depicts a figure standing on a cliff, gazing out over the sea with three wands planted firmly in the ground behind them. This imagery represents a moment of contemplation before embarking on a journey or venture. The wands symbolize creativity, ambition, and the tools you’ve cultivated to achieve your goals. The figure’s gaze toward the horizon signifies looking ahead, assessing opportunities, and preparing for what’s to come. This card encourages you to trust your instincts and take calculated risks, as the groundwork has already been laid for success.
The Symbolism of Progress in the Three of Wands
Progress is a central theme of the Three of Wands. Unlike the initial spark of inspiration represented by the Ace of Wands or the action-oriented energy of the Two of Wands, the Three of Wands embodies the stage where you’ve started to see tangible results from your efforts. The wands in the card are firmly planted, indicating stability and a solid foundation. This suggests that you’ve invested time and energy into a project or goal, and now it’s time to evaluate your progress. The card encourages you to reflect on how far you’ve come and to recognize the milestones you’ve achieved. It’s a reminder that progress isn’t always linear—it requires patience, adaptability, and a willingness to adjust your course as needed.
In a reading, the Three of Wands may appear when you’re on the verge of a breakthrough. It signals that you’re moving in the right direction, even if the final outcome isn’t yet visible. This card is a sign to stay the course and trust that your efforts will bear fruit. It also highlights the importance of setting clear intentions and having a vision for the future. Without a destination in mind, progress can feel aimless. The Three of Wands urges you to define your goals and take deliberate steps toward achieving them.

Common Misconceptions About the Three of Wands
Despite its positive energy, the Three of Wands is sometimes misunderstood. One common misconception is that this card guarantees instant success. While it does indicate progress and opportunity, it doesn’t promise that everything will fall into place effortlessly. Success still requires hard work, patience, and perseverance. The Three of Wands is a sign that you’re on the right path, but it’s up to you to keep moving forward.
Another misconception is that the Three of Wands is only about external achievements, such as career success or travel. While these are certainly themes, the card also speaks to internal growth. It encourages you to cultivate a sense of adventure in your daily life, whether that’s through learning a new skill, exploring a hobby, or deepening your relationships. The opportunities it represents aren’t just about external validation—they’re about becoming the best version of yourself.
Lastly, some people associate the Three of Wands with recklessness, as it encourages taking risks. However, this card is not about impulsive decisions. It’s about calculated risks—those that are well-researched and aligned with your goals. The figure in the card is standing on a cliff, not jumping blindly into the unknown. Similarly, you should approach opportunities with a blend of courage and wisdom.
